#dead51 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dead51 is composed of 87.1% red, 67.8%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 22.1% magenta, 63.5%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 39.1 degrees, a saturation of 68.1% and a lightness of 59.4%. #dead51 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a2 with #bd5b00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#dead51 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#dead51 has RGB values of R:222, G:173, B:81 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.22, Y:0.64,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 14593361.

Shades and Tints of #dead51

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070501 is the darkest color, while #fdfbf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#dead51

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9e9a91 is the less saturated color, while #feb731 is the most saturated one.
